The foundation of the modern global economy is built on a dense network of counterparty trust and risk. In the past 50 years, companies have evolved from relying on a couple of wholesalers and vendors, to utilizing 100+ SaaS vendors, contract partners, and cloud providers. Since each counterparty has their own idiosyncratic internal processes and risk profiles, businesses end up spending millions of dollars and countless man-hours conducting due diligence.
Coverbase’s mission is to streamline this business-to-business assessment, reducing human toil, and allowing organizations to work together safely and reliably. We employ modern AI techniques to organize vast amounts of unstructured data and compare them against policies to identify key risks to the business.
We serve customers across Fortune 500 companies in insurance, higher education, and finance — including five of the top 25 banks in the US.
